Output da5f106bf78947e286cd1b68d7e8c1ad44fa4a381950858d89edb8875343786e:8

value
49996526
script pubkey
OP_0 OP_PUSHBYTES_20 ded6701445a1f51184ba27b3d8d6e83088b11306
address
bc1qmmt8q9z95863rp96y7ea34hgxzytzycxu086jg
transaction
da5f106bf78947e286cd1b68d7e8c1ad44fa4a381950858d89edb8875343786e
confirmations
138387
spent
true